<li>1. 異地化服務(wù)<br>2. 數(shù)據(jù)庫遷移<br>3. 應(yīng)用程序改造</li>
這段文字描述了將異地化服務(wù)作為企業(yè)戰(zhàn)略的一部分,旨在將重要數(shù)據(jù)庫遷移到新的服務(wù)器上,以提高數(shù)據(jù)安全性,在實際實施過程中,可能會遇到一系列技術(shù)和商業(yè)上的挑戰(zhàn)。
數(shù)據(jù)庫遷移是一個復(fù)雜的過程,需要仔細(xì)規(guī)劃,企業(yè)應(yīng)考慮以下步驟:
1、數(shù)據(jù)分析:了解現(xiàn)有數(shù)據(jù)庫的結(jié)構(gòu)和功能,以便制定最佳的遷移計劃。
2、數(shù)據(jù)清理:刪除不再使用的舊數(shù)據(jù),確保新數(shù)據(jù)庫中的數(shù)據(jù)完整準(zhǔn)確。
3、數(shù)據(jù)復(fù)制:將數(shù)據(jù)庫從舊服務(wù)器復(fù)制到新服務(wù)器,確保數(shù)據(jù)的一致性和完整性。
4、數(shù)據(jù)校驗:對比兩個數(shù)據(jù)庫之間的數(shù)據(jù)一致性,以確保遷移過程沒有錯誤。
5、運行測試:在生產(chǎn)環(huán)境中測試遷移后的應(yīng)用程序,確保所有功能都正常工作。
6、后端調(diào)整:根據(jù)新數(shù)據(jù)庫的特性,可能需要調(diào)整應(yīng)用程序的后端代碼。
7、前端適配:如果應(yīng)用程序是基于前端框架構(gòu)建的,那么還需要進(jìn)行前端的適配工作。
第二步是應(yīng)用程序改造,企業(yè)應(yīng)考慮以下幾個關(guān)鍵點:
1、API接口升級:重新設(shè)計API接口,使它們能夠與新的數(shù)據(jù)庫兼容。
2、故障轉(zhuǎn)移策略:為應(yīng)用程序添加故障轉(zhuǎn)移機制,確保在主服務(wù)器出現(xiàn)問題時,能無縫切換到備用服務(wù)器。
3、測試和優(yōu)化:進(jìn)行全面的性能測試和負(fù)載測試,確保應(yīng)用程序能夠在新的環(huán)境下穩(wěn)定運行。
4、用戶界面調(diào)整:如果應(yīng)用程序的用戶界面依賴于特定的布局或樣式,則需要進(jìn)行調(diào)整。
5、客戶體驗改善:優(yōu)化用戶體驗,例如增加加載時間限制,提高響應(yīng)速度等。
第三步是異地化服務(wù)的實施,這個階段的工作主要包括:
1、數(shù)據(jù)遷移:將數(shù)據(jù)從舊服務(wù)器遷移到新服務(wù)器,同時要確保數(shù)據(jù)的一致性和完整性。
2、應(yīng)用程序部署:將應(yīng)用程序從舊服務(wù)器轉(zhuǎn)移到新服務(wù)器,可能需要進(jìn)行一些額外的配置和調(diào)整。
3、監(jiān)控和日志記錄:在新環(huán)境中監(jiān)控應(yīng)用程序的表現(xiàn),同時記錄詳細(xì)的日志文件,以便后續(xù)分析和調(diào)試。
4、安全性評估:檢查新環(huán)境的安全性,包括身份驗證、訪問控制等方面,確保沒有任何漏洞。
企業(yè)應(yīng)該密切關(guān)注這些步驟中可能出現(xiàn)的各種風(fēng)險,如數(shù)據(jù)丟失、系統(tǒng)崩潰、網(wǎng)絡(luò)中斷等問題,為了應(yīng)對這些問題,企業(yè)可以采取以下措施:
1、備份數(shù)據(jù):確保在任何情況下都有數(shù)據(jù)備份,以防數(shù)據(jù)丟失或損壞。
2、定期巡檢:安排技術(shù)人員定期檢查新環(huán)境的運行情況,及時發(fā)現(xiàn)并解決問題。
3、緊急恢復(fù)計劃:制定緊急恢復(fù)計劃,以便在出現(xiàn)重大問題時能夠迅速恢復(fù)正常服務(wù)。
4、遵守法律法規(guī):確保所有的操作都符合當(dāng)?shù)胤煞ㄒ?guī)的要求,防止因法律糾紛而導(dǎo)致的損失。
將異地化服務(wù)作為一種戰(zhàn)略手段,不僅可以提高數(shù)據(jù)安全性,還可以降低成本、提高效率,這需要企業(yè)和技術(shù)人員共同努力,克服各種技術(shù)和商業(yè)上的挑戰(zhàn),才能真正實現(xiàn)目標(biāo)。